F1's 2017 rules shake-up too early to help make Renault winners
Renault has played down talk that 2017's Formula 1 rules overhaul will give it an opportunity to fast-track its route back to the top of the sport. The French car manufacturer is undergoing a restructuring of its Enstone-based operation following the takeover of Lotus last year, and has mapped out a three-year plan to finish on the podium. And although the arrival of faster F1 cars next year is expected to shake up the order, Renault thinks it will still need more time before it can become a contender at the front of the grid.
